How to implement reliable craps tricks in online play
- Choose bets with low house edge start by favoring pass line come bets and the odds wager where available. These bets give you the best long term value and a fair chance to win without aggressive variance.
- Use odds and place bets strategically when the platform allows add odds to your pass line or come bets. Place bets on five six eight and nine as they typically offer solid returns with relatively small swings.
- Manage your bankroll with a plan define a daily or session limit and stick to it. Separate your stake for bets and a reserve for sustaining through losing streaks. Consistency beats big single wins.
- Pause and adjust after big wins or losses set a rule to reset if your balance moves by a fixed percentage. This keeps you in control and prevents chasing losses.
- Leverage simplified betting when new to the table avoid exotic bets and focus on core bets until you build confidence with the rhythm of the game.
How to track results and adapt your approach
Keep a simple log of outcomes for a few sessions. Note which bets worked best during hot streaks and which ones drained your balance during cold spells. Use the data to refine your wagering plan and to stay aligned with the math behind craps tricks that actually work for online players.

What bets should I start with in online craps to maximize value? Begin with pass line and come bets along with the odds where available. These offer the best house edge and reliable paths to progress.
How do I manage a online craps session without chasing losses? Use a fixed bankroll plan and set loss and win limits. If you hit a limit pause for reflection before continuing.

Are there tricks that guarantee wins in online craps No strategy guarantees a win each time. The goal is to improve long term value and reduce risk through smart bet selection and disciplined play.
